Legendary millionaire Benjamin Guggenheim is shown refusing a life vest, famously stating he is dressed in his best and prepared to go down like a gentleman. A deleted extension shows his valet, Victor Giglio, echoing the sentiment, adding a poignant layer of loyalty amidst the chaos. 4. Expanded Secondary Character Arcs
